Since GNU maintainers (in theory) already upload their stuff to
ftp.gnu.org or alpha.gnu.org using that file triplet it might be nice
if something could be worked into their existing workflow. Perhaps new
commands in the directive file to do the things you describe? This
would probably require coordinating with the FSF sysadmin.
Perhaps, in time, the things you describe could be even done by
default when new things are uploaded, since (I think) maintainers get
emails about stuff they upload anyway it seems like a good time to
include the output of the stuff you described?
